The I-5 Interstate Bridge Replacement project has reached a significant milestone by completing its federal environmental review. This approval is crucial for moving forward with the first phase of construction.
While the project is set to advance, it is not without its challenges. Internal strife regarding key elements of the program continues to pose hurdles that stakeholders must address.
